    The list of skills each class has that people may feel they have no immunity to should not include talons. You have many counters available to you provided by basic movement options, blocking, champion point tree, bash, skills that stun, skills that interrupt. One cannot expect to stand idle and not have a particular ability, whether it's a stun, snare, or attack to be spammed on you. It's not a hard stun. Bottom line is that you are refusing to acknowledge that there are many tactics you can implement to elude talons, and it really doesn't take much creativity, effort, or skill. DK, especially Magicka DK is widely known, and especially on these forums, by overwhelming consensus as being A. The hardest class to play effectively in the current environment, and B. Lacking many mechanics that all other classes have available to them. As you can see the "Agree" numbers on the threads disagreeing with the OP vastly outnumber anyone agreeing with the OP. We can agree to respectfully disagree, and I apologize if I breached forum etiquette or come of as brash. The vast majority, myself included, disagree that Talons is even remotely close to being categorized as a flaw in the game. Especially, when we already have real issues with unbreakable, unblockable, stuns that you cannot dodge roll out of, i.e. perma stuns. Talons is working as intended and couldn't pose a hindrance to me beyond making me dodge roll and apply my own stun or snare on the caster.

    I don't mean to throw L2P, but a magicka DK, especially as they stand now, is not an unfavorable match-up for a templar. Most of their tricks have hard counters for templars. Dots -> cleanse. Flame lash -> Eclipse. Melee stuff - > Puncturing sweep. No mobility -> You get to fight inside your purifying ritual. Their best ultimate (meteor) -> cleansed. They flap -> I don't care I don't use projectiles.
